Blykalla advances SMR deployment with second Swedish plant application
Blykalla has submitted a second application for a small modular reactor project in Sweden, following an earlier proposal filed in May for a six-unit installation in Norrsundet within the Gävle municipality in east central Sweden. The company, which develops the SEALER (Swedish Advanced Lead Reactor) technology, targets locations where advanced nuclear power can serve industrial and regional needs beyond traditional large-reactor sites.
Blykalla's strategy emphasizes geographic flexibility. According to CEO Jacob Stedman, the company seeks "locations across Sweden where advanced nuclear power will deliver the greatest value," noting that lead-cooled reactors enable deployment "closer to industry, in new municipalities and inland locations where traditional nuclear power has historically not been possible."
Technology and timeline
Blykalla originated as a spin-off from KTH Royal Institute of Technology in Stockholm, where lead-cooled reactor research has proceeded since 1996. The company was established in 2013 and is developing the SEALER-55 unit, rated at 140 MWt and 55 MWe. The company targets commercial operation of its first reactor in the early 2030s.
Swedish state-aid framework
Sweden's parliament approved state financing mechanisms for new nuclear investment in May of the prior year. The framework provides loans to reduce financing costs for qualifying projects, capped at approximately 5,000 MWe of total capacity across supported reactors. Eligibility requires co-location of reactors with combined output of at least 300 MWe.
Financial support takes the form of two-way Contracts for Difference, available once a reactor achieves operational status and receives a license for full-capacity electricity production. The state-aid act entered force on 1 August, opening applications to interested developers. Multiple companies have since applied, including Blykalla, positioning the framework as a significant mechanism for SMR and large-reactor deployment in the Nordic region.
